Easement apart from the___________heritage can’t be transferred
Undominant
Right of re-entry
Dominant
None
- Easement: A right to cross or use someone else's land for a specified purpose.
- Undominant: Not a relevant term in an easement context.
- Right of re-entry: Right to retake possession of a property under certain conditions. Does not apply to easements.
- Dominant: Refers to the dominant tenement which benefits from the easement. Easements cannot be transferred apart from the dominant heritage.
- None: Indicates no correct option, which is not applicable here as "Dominant" is correct.
